Led by head coach Kirby Smart, the Georgia Bulldogs have already assembled an impressive 2026 recruiting class, ranking No. 1 in the nation with 29 commitments, and they could soon make another big addition.
On Monday, Rivals' Hayes Fawcett reported that they, along with the Clemson Tigers, the Oregon Ducks and the Texas Longhorns, were named the four finalists for linebacker Tyler Atkinson, who will be making the decision on Tuesday.
The Bulldogs have been especially active in Atkinson's recruiting process, hosting him a total of 14 times, while the linebacker is also from Lawrenceville, Georgia, which is nearly an hour from Athens.
Unfortunately for them, though, things are starting to trend in the wrong direction, because on Monday, Rivals' Steve Wiltfong and Chad Simmons both logged expert predictions for Atkinson to commit to Texas.

This outcome would be huge for the Longhorns, as Rivals Industry Rankings place him as a five-star recruit, the No. 1 linebacker, the No. 1 player in Georgia and the No. 9 player in the nation.
Over the past three seasons for Grayson High School, he's put up some extremely impressive numbers, accumulating 475 tackles, 79 tackles for loss, 31.5 sacks, 93 hurries, seven pass deflections, and four forced fumbles.
What would make this addition for Texas even more exciting is that Atkinson could be their third five-star addition, joining quarterback Dia Bell and EDGE Richard Wesley.
On the other hand, for Georgia and Smart, this would sting a bit more, as they've only been able to land one linebacker in the 2026 recruiting class so far in the form of four-star Shadarius Toodle.
